"""
Stripe payment integration for subscriptions and credits
"""
import os
import logging
from typing import Optional, Dict, Any
from datetime import datetime
logger = logging.getLogger(__name__)
# Try to import stripe
try:
import stripe
STRIPE_AVAILABLE = True
except ImportError:
STRIPE_AVAILABLE = False
stripe = None
from models.subscription import PlanType, PLANS, CREDIT_PACKAGES, SubscriptionStatus
from services.auth_service import get_user_by_id, update_user, add_credits
from services.pricing_config import (
get_subscription_line_amount_eur,
stripe_price_ids_for_plan,
)
# Stripe configuration
STRIPE_WEBHOOK_SECRET = os.getenv("STRIPE_WEBHOOK_SECRET", "")
STRIPE_PUBLISHABLE_KEY = os.getenv("STRIPE_PUBLISHABLE_KEY", "")
def _get_stripe_secret_key() -> str:
"""Read Stripe secret key at runtime to support hot-reload/admin updates."""
return os.getenv("STRIPE_SECRET_KEY", "").strip()
def _ensure_stripe_client_configured() -> bool:
"""Configure Stripe SDK lazily with the latest key from environment."""
if not STRIPE_AVAILABLE:
return False
secret = _get_stripe_secret_key()
if not secret:
return False
stripe.api_key = secret
return True
def is_stripe_configured() -> bool:
"""Check if Stripe is properly configured"""
return _ensure_stripe_client_configured()
async def create_checkout_session(
user_id: str,
plan: PlanType,
billing_period: str = "monthly", # monthly or yearly
success_url: str = "",
cancel_url: str = "",
) -> Optional[Dict[str, Any]]:
"""Create a Stripe checkout session for subscription"""
if not is_stripe_configured():
return {"error": "Stripe not configured", "demo_mode": True}
user = get_user_by_id(user_id)
if not user:
return {"error": "User not found"}
plan_config = PLANS[plan]
plan_id = plan.value
mid, yid = stripe_price_ids_for_plan(plan_id)
price_id = mid if billing_period == "monthly" else yid
# If no Stripe price id is configured, fall back to inline price_data.
# This makes test-mode checkout work with only STRIPE_SECRET_KEY configured.
line_item: Dict[str, Any]
if price_id and price_id not in ("price_xxx", ""):
line_item = {"price": price_id, "quantity": 1}
else:
amount = get_subscription_line_amount_eur(plan, billing_period)
if amount in (None, "", -1) or float(amount) <= 0:
return {
"error": "Impossible de créer le checkout: tarif invalide pour ce forfait."
}
amount_cents = int(round(float(amount) * 100))
interval = "year" if billing_period == "yearly" else "month"
line_item = {
"price_data": {
"currency": "eur",
"unit_amount": amount_cents,
"recurring": {"interval": interval},
"product_data": {
"name": f"Office Translator - {plan_config.get('name', plan_id)}"
},
},
"quantity": 1,
}
try:
# Create or get Stripe customer
if user.stripe_customer_id:
customer_id = user.stripe_customer_id
else:
customer = stripe.Customer.create(
email=user.email,
name=user.name,
metadata={"user_id": user_id}
)
customer_id = customer.id
update_user(user_id, {"stripe_customer_id": customer_id})
# Create checkout session
session = stripe.checkout.Session.create(
customer=customer_id,
mode="subscription",
payment_method_types=["card"],
line_items=[line_item],
success_url=success_url or f"{os.getenv('FRONTEND_URL', 'http://localhost:3000')}/dashboard?session_id={{CHECKOUT_SESSION_ID}}",
cancel_url=cancel_url or f"{os.getenv('FRONTEND_URL', 'http://localhost:3000')}/pricing",
metadata={"user_id": user_id, "plan": plan.value},
subscription_data={
"metadata": {"user_id": user_id, "plan": plan.value}
}
)
return {
"session_id": session.id,
"url": session.url
}
except Exception as e:
return {"error": str(e)}

async def handle_webhook(payload: bytes, sig_header: str) -> Dict[str, Any]:
"""Handle Stripe webhook events"""
if not is_stripe_configured():
return {"error": "Stripe not configured"}
try:
event = stripe.Webhook.construct_event(
payload, sig_header, STRIPE_WEBHOOK_SECRET
)
except ValueError:
return {"error": "Invalid payload"}
except stripe.error.SignatureVerificationError:
return {"error": "Invalid signature"}
# Handle the event
if event["type"] == "checkout.session.completed":
session = event["data"]["object"]
await handle_checkout_completed(session)
elif event["type"] == "customer.subscription.updated":
subscription = event["data"]["object"]
await handle_subscription_updated(subscription)
elif event["type"] == "customer.subscription.deleted":
subscription = event["data"]["object"]
await handle_subscription_deleted(subscription)
elif event["type"] == "invoice.payment_failed":
invoice = event["data"]["object"]
await handle_payment_failed(invoice)
return {"status": "success"}
